A Study on the Synthetic Characteristics of the Extracellular Polysaccharide (EPS) of Ganoderma lucidum Cultured in Batch Fermentation Using a Kinetic Model
Authors:Jian-Guo ZHANG  Xiao-Ming CHEN  Xin-Sheng HE
Institution:aSchool of Life Science and Engineering, Southwest University of Science and Technology, Mianyang 621010, China
Abstract:The synthetic characteristics of the extracellular polysaccharide (EPS) of Ganoderma lucidum in batch fermentation were studied. The result showed that the production of EPS was partially growth-associated. The cell dry weight (CDW) and EPS reached 15.56 g·L−1 and 3.02 g·L−1, respectively. The yield of EPS to cell dry weight (Yp/x) was 0.19. On the basis of the test results of batch fermentation, a kinetic model was proposed by using the Logistic equation for cell growth, the Luedeking–Piret equation for EPS production, and the Luedeking-piret-like equation for the consumption of glucose as substrate. The calculated results using these models were satisfactorily compared with the experimental data under various concentrations of glucose, and the average of relative errors was found to be not more than 5%. The kinetic model had practical guidance interesting in producing PES by Ganoderma lucidum.
Keywords:Ganoderma lucidum  extracellular polysaccharide  fermentation kinetics model
